Where to Move in Europe for a Higher Salary

We mapped out software engineer salaries across Europe and how much they've grown over one year, and one country surprised us!
This is what we found:
Salaries across most of Europe have basically stopped moving… they’re just about keeping up with inflation at around 1-2%.
Sweden is the exception - jumping over 5%, and 17% percent the year before that, due to a growing tech scene and companies competing hard for engineers.
So if you're targeting a high salary or pay rise, maybe Sweden is the place to be!

Sweden: The Full Picture
Other than pay rises, there are a few more things to consider before relocating to Sweden:
Tax is high - Reaching 50%+ at senior salary levels, be sure to use a tax calculator before accepting a job.
Language can cap your ceiling - Most Stockholm tech companies hire in English, but leadership roles, internal politics, and career progression often favour Swedish speakers.
EU Blue Card — Sweden participates in the EU Blue Card scheme, making it one of the more accessible routes for non-EU engineers.
Long-term wealth potential is real - Lower CoL than London, strong public services, and a culture that values work-life balance.
Stockholm is the hub, but there are other options — Gothenburg and Malmö have growing tech scenes with less competition and lower rents.
